Story Time at The Boot Factory with Waverley Library – A Magical Morning for Little Bookworms

Looking for a fun, free and engaging activity to share with your preschooler? Join Waverley Library for Story Time @ The Boot Factory – a delightful morning of stories, rhymes and creativity designed especially for children aged 3 to 5 years. Held in the beautifully refurbished Boot Factory in Bondi Junction, this 30-minute session is perfect for little imaginations. Expect an interactive program of storytelling, playful rhymes and plenty of giggles – all designed to encourage a love of books and reading from an early age. Looking for a fun and educational after-school activity for your little one? Watsons Bay Library is hosting a free Mini Makers: Coding with Osmo session on Wednesday, 6 August 2025, from 4:00 PM to 5:00 PM — and it’s perfect for curious kids aged 5 to 9! This hands-on workshop is a gentle and engaging introduction to the world of coding, designed specifically for young beginners. Using Osmo kits, children will explore basic coding concepts by physically placing blocks and creating sequences to guide characters through interactive challenges.
